WebMay 22, 2012 · A knee brace (also referred to as a gable or eave bracket) is a diagonal support placed between two right-angle planes to strengthen their connection. You'll often find knee braces on Craftsman homes with gable roofs. The gable end of a roof typically has eaves formed by lookouts; these eaves happen to be the perfect location for knee … WebAug 1, 2005 · I am building a porch that has a lot of 6 x 6 pt post the support the roof.
